网络版配置桥接网卡

4.2 网络配置 配置一个桥接网卡)

管理机网桥配置  虚拟机网络配置

4.2.1 管理机网桥配置

1)openEuler技术路线

序号

配置过程说明

命令行

1

进入网络配置目录

# cd /etc/sysconfig/network-scripts

2

新建文件:ifcfg-br0

# touch ifcfg-br0

3

编辑ifcfg-br0,粘贴下面ifcfg-br0文件内容

# nano ifcfg-br0

4

编辑物理网卡配置文件,其中em1为物理网卡名称

# nano ifcfg-em1

5

进入网络管理器目录

# cd /etc/NetworkManager/dispatcher.d

6

编辑br0网桥iptables规则

# touch 50-br0-iptables

7

应用规则

# chmod +x /etc/NetworkManager/dispatcher.d/50-br0-iptables

8

重新装载网卡配置

# nmcli connection reload

9

重启系统

# reboot

ifcfg-br0文件内容

TYPE=Bridge

PROXY_METHOD=none

BROWSER_ONLY=no

BOOTPROTO=none

DEFROUTE=yes

IPV4_FAILURE_FATAL=no

IPV6INIT=yes

IPV6_AUTOCONF=yes

IPV6_DEFROUTE=yes

IPV6_FAILURE_FATAL=no

IPV6_ADDR_GEN_MODE=stable-privacy

IPV6_PRIVACY=no

NAME=br0

DEVICE=br0

ONBOOT=yes

IPADDR=<IP>      //静态IP地址

PREFIX=<PREFIX>    //子网掩码

GATEWAY=<GATEWAY>   //网关地址

DNS1=<DNS>          //域名服务器

ifcfg-em1文件内容

TYPE=Ethernet

PROXY_METHOD=none

BROWSER_ONLY=no

BOOTPROTO=none

NAME=<物理网络名称>

UUID=dc353219-2387-4a9d-a9e1-a1a19d5df98f

DEVICE=<物理网络名称>

ONBOOT=yes

BRIDGE=br0

50-br0-iptables文件内容

#!/bin/sh

[ "$1" = "br0" ] && [ "$2" = "up" ] && /usr/sbin/iptables -A FORWARD -s 0.0.0.0/0 -d 0.0.0.0/0 -o br0 -i br0 -j ACCEPT

[ "$1" = "br0" ] && [ "$2" = "down" ] && /usr/sbin/iptables -D FORWARD -s 0.0.0.0/0 -d 0.0.0.0/0 -o br0 -i br0 -j ACCEPT

 

 

 

序号

配置过程说明

命令行

1

进入网络配置目录

# cd /etc/network/

2

编辑网络配置文件:interfaces

# nano interfaces

3

重启系统

# reboot

2)Debian技术路线

interfaces文件内容

# This file describes the network interfaces available on your system

# and how to activate them. For more information, see interfaces(5).

source /etc/network/interfaces.d/*

# The loopback network interface

 

auto lo

iface lo inet loopback

 

# The primary network interface

allow-hotplug <网卡名称>

iface <网卡名称> inet manual

 

auto br0

iface br0 inet static

  address *.*.*.*/*

  gateway *.*.*.*

  dns-nameservers *.*.*.*

  bridge_ports <网卡名称>

  bridge_stp off

  bridge_fd 0

  bridge_maxwait 0

  post-up /usr/sbin/iptables -A FORWARD -s 0.0.0.0/0 -d 0.0.0.0/0 -o br0 -i br0 -j ACCEPT

 

行业动态